Patent images of Aprilia RS660 leaked online
KUALA LUMPUR: Aprilia is expected to soon bring its very own middleweight supersport bike to the global market. And it’ll all begin with the introduction of Aprilia RS660, well that’s what the company hopes for. Aprilia seems quite serious about converting its concept bike into a production-spec model. Putting an approval stamp on the deal are the patent images filed in Australia.
The CAD images that you can see in the article are the same patent filings done by Aprilia in Australia. And the bike in the images tallies with the EICMA concept to a great extent with only a few differences. Like the forks now seem to be Sachs and not Ohlins as fitted in the model displayed at EICMA 2018. Also, the Brembo Stylemas front brake callipers have been replaced by ‘regular’ monoblocs unit. The primary reason for the shift we feel is cost cutting, thus making the bike affordable to the masses.
However, remember that Aprilia more than often offers its bikes in two trim - Standard and Factory variants. The later ones are fully loaded in the electronics and chassis department, like in the case of Tuono V4 and RSV4. The same thing can be true for the RS660.
One of the key highlights of the bike is aero body applications. There have been talks about a feature called Aprilia Active Aerodynamics system. However, what it does and how it operates remains unknown.
According to the sources, the production-spec Aprilia RS660 will be unveiled at the EICMA 2019.
